Rent increase rules in Milwaukee

Wisconsin bans local rent control. Milwaukee has no cap; 28-day (one rental period) notice is required.

State rules that apply in Milwaukee

No statewide rent cap; local rent control prohibited. 28-day written notice (one rental period) required. Required notice: 28 days.
